Meant as a warning of the threat to the world’s coral reefs, photographer Alicja Wróblewska has caused a splash with her striking, brightly-coloured compositions of reused plastic items.
Coral reefs form an underwater ecosystem characterised by their diversity of life, something that has seen them dubbed the “rainforests of the sea”. However, a large share of the earth’s coral reefs are threatened by human activity, with serious implications for marine biodiversity. An estimated 90% of reefs will be under threat by 2030, and all of them by 2050.
